Don Block, age 86 of Kimberly, ascended to the arms of his waiting Lord on Ascension Day, May 5, 2016. Don was born in Gillett, Wisconsin, on June 9, 1929, son of the late Adolph and Clara (Andersen) Block. On June 8, 1957, he married Joyous Spilker in West Allis. Together, the couple enjoyed fifty-nine years together and were blessed with four children. In his youth, Don attended Gillett Grade School and High School, and spent one year at Wartburg College. Returning to Milwaukee, he worked at Pritzlaff Hardware and Koehring Corporation. In 1967, the family moved to Appleton where Don became employed by Kimberly Clark Corporation. He retired in 1987, and moved to Kimberly in 1996.
He was a longtime and faithful member of Good Shepherd Lutheran Church where he was active in many activities, including serving as a Boy Scout leader, attending bible study, Men's Fellowship group, sponsoring Hmong families, and was the official church hugger, greeter, and honorary grandpa. Don was also part of the Salvation Army Board of Directors, and volunteered as a driver for Calumet County programs.
